Transaction 64264b59d1984fadc214929ab36dd6858436745c5ad82e384b76aee907f7f331
1 Input
1 Output
-
64264b59d1984fadc214929ab36dd6858436745c5ad82e384b76aee907f7f331:0
- value
- 149801
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ee96502bd74c9fad4b57d263411e113f0309bec2 OP_EQUAL
- address
- 3PSYp9A9hY2gi3mv94nVgHHHzJbtYfMo8P